WebMar 14, 2024 · The greater the bond length in the compound, the lesser the bond angle will be and the greater the electron density of the substituent atoms in the compound, … WebCorrect option is C) In NF 3, N is less electronegative as compared to F but in NH 3, it is more electronegative than H. And in case of same central atom, as the electronegativity of other atoms increases, bond angle decreases. Thus, bond angle in NF 3 is smaller than that in NH 3 because of the difference in the polarity of N in these molecules. WebApr 15, 2024 · Bond pairs are near fluorine, this would lead to more b.p.l.p. repulsion and to minimize it, bond angle decreases. WebThe difference in bond angles in $\ce{NF3}$ and $\ce{NH3}$ is only determined by the electronegativity difference between the central atom and the bonded atom. As $\ce{F}$ is more electronegative than $\ce{H}$, in $\ce{NH3}$, bonding electron pair shifts more towards $\ce{N}$ than they shift in $\ce{NF3}$. So, the bond angle increases. There is ...
